Bears Hold Off Pacific In Midweek Win

Cal Snaps 3-Game Losing Skid With Win Over Tigers

STOCKTON – The California softball team defeated Pacific 6-5 on Tuesday evening at Bill Simoni Field.

The Tigers jumped out to an early 1-0 lead in the first inning.

 

Madison Rey responded in the second with her first home run of the season to tie the game at 1-1.

 

In the third, Gator Robinson gave the Bears their first lead with a solo shot to left field to make it 2-1.

 

Cal added three runs in the fourth to extend the advantage to 5-1. Sophia Everett and Robinson each drove in a run with singles, and Robinson later scored on a Pacific fielding error.

 

Kayli Counts pushed the lead to 6-1 in the fifth on a fielder's choice.

 

Pacific cut into the deficit with a solo home run in the sixth to make it 6-2.

 

The Tigers mounted a late rally in the seventh, scoring three runs, but were unable to bring home the tying run as the Bears held on for the 6-5 victory.

 

Layna Gerhard (3-1) earned the win, allowing two runs on two hits while striking out three. Kiki Mashhoud recorded her first save of the season, entering the game with no outs and the winning run at the plate. 

 

Cal (9-17) returns to action on Friday in Saratoga with a matchup against North Carolina. First pitch for Game 1 is scheduled for 2 p.m. PT.
